Come posso mappare lo scorrimento di due dita di Apple Magic Mouse con le funzioni back and forward di un browser web?

12

L'Apple Magic Mouse sembra funzionare finora con Ubuntu, ma solo un paio di funzioni multitouch sembrano funzionare. Con il trackpad, ci sono molte altre funzioni con utouch. Quello che mi piacerebbe davvero fare è mappare gli swip a due dita in avanti / indietro in un browser.

    
posta Jon 06.06.2012 - 23:16
fonte

5 risposte

1

Ho impostato questo e molti altri gesti con touchegg. Installalo tramite:

sudo apt-get install touchegg

Configura touchegg tramite il suo file di configurazione che si trova qui:

~/.config/touchegg/touchegg.conf

La configurazione per i tuoi gesti desiderati sarebbe la seguente.

<touchégg>

<settings>
    <property name="composed_gestures_time">15000</property>
</settings>

<application name="All">      

    <gesture type="DRAG" fingers="2" direction="LEFT">
        <action type="SEND_KEYS">Alt+Right</action>
    </gesture>

    <gesture type="DRAG" fingers="2" direction="RIGHT">
        <action type="SEND_KEYS">Alt+Left</action>
    </gesture>

</application>

È importante seguire l'ultimo suggerimento delle Domande frequenti se desideri impostare due o tre dita gesti.

 synclient TapButton2=0
 synclient TapButton3=0
 synclient ClickFinger2=0
 synclient ClickFinger3=0
 synclient HorizTwoFingerScroll=0
 synclient VertTwoFingerScroll=0

Crea uno script di shell eseguibile e attivalo all'avvio.

Disattiva i due e tre tocchi e i clic del driver synaptics e lo scorrimento con due dita. Se vuoi tenere il dito con due dita per fare clic con il pulsante destro del mouse e lo scorrimento con due dita, devi farlo anche con touchegg.

Penso che il mouse magico si riporti come un trackpad come indicato qui .

    
risposta data neun24 21.01.2014 - 12:22
fonte
1

Non sono sicuro che funzionerà con Magic Mouse, ma con Magic Trackpad ho usato con successo xSwipe per riavere il browser / navigazione in avanti, interruttore dell'area di lavoro, azioni Scale ed Expo.

    
risposta data varepsilon 11.08.2014 - 11:13
fonte
0

Hai provato touchegg? Sono stato in grado di definire alcuni gesti sul touchpad del mio MacBook.

link

    
risposta data kekio 20.01.2014 - 19:34
fonte
0

Il riconoscimento di gesti di Easystroke può associare un gesto a un'applicazione. puoi trovare il riconoscimento gestuale di Eystroke nel centro del software ubuntu.

    
risposta data adi71094 15.06.2014 - 07:21
fonte
0

Al momento della stesura di questo, il driver del mouse hid-magicmouse non segnala lo scorrimento con due dita in modo diverso da un dito. Quindi nessuna soluzione a livello di applicazione è possibile. Devi guardare lo sviluppo del modulo del kernel. Magic Mouse è visto nel sistema come un mouse molto semplice con due rotelline. Non verrà rilevato da alcun software touchpad.
Al contrario, Apple Magic Touch è visto come un touchpad molto avanzato e può essere assegnato a molte più funzioni rispetto a MacOS.

    
risposta data Barafu Albino 21.10.2014 - 13:50
fonte

Leggi altre domande sui tag